Visuals: https://getbehindthebillboard.com/episode-91-gary-fawcett-amp-lisa-nicholsPodcast episode #91 features Gary Fawcett & Lisa Nichols, ECDs at TBWA\MCR, in the second part in our Manchester special.Gary & Lisa have worked in the business for over 25 years, for a huge array of clients including Pizza Hut, British Airways, EA Games and Harvey Nichols. Their work has been recognised at Cannes, D&AD, The One Show, New York Festivals, Epica and London International Awards.We spent a lovely hour chatting all things Manchester, advertising and a tiny bit of football (Gary, like Hugh, is a long suffering United fan).We discussed how to crop a man’s elbow perfectly to resemble a man’s bottom for prostate charity Prost8. A brilliant and incredibly important campaign which has been one of our favourites for ages now.We covered the Stop Homelessness Spiking work highlighting the worrying trend of harmful architecture. The work is graphic and disturbing and we really hope it helps. To learn more go to hostiledesign.orgWe also discussed classic OOH campaigns for Harvey Nichols Manchester, British Airways, MBNA, Anti-Knife Crime and appropriately enough ending on the Lowry Centre which we could see from GAS studios.Thank you Gary & Lisa so much for coming in and sharing your work in such friendly and humble fashion.
